The minimum tick is one-quarter of an index point, or $12.50 per contract. If E-mini S&P 500 futures rise or fall, say, 30 points (about 1%), that translates into a gain or loss of $1,500 (30 points/0.25 minimum tick = 120 ticks; 120 x $12.50 = $1,500). These contracts trade ...Forex Futures vs Forwards. The main difference between forwards and futures contracts is that the latter are standardized. This means forex futures come in set sizes and do not allow customization. Also, clearing houses settle them according to standard procedures. For example, a mini euro or a British …One-Cancels-the-Other (OCO) An OCO order is a combination of two entry and/or stop loss orders. Two orders are placed above and below the current price. When one of the orders is executed the other order is canceled. An OCO order allows you to place two orders at the same time.
